We are seeking a Project Manager for Atkinson Construction, a heavy civil subsidiary of Clark Construction. A Project Manager is the principal company representative at project sites and oversees the entirety of multiple projects. Project Managers "set the tone". They engage in and influence our safety culture and have the authority to make decisions on Atkinson's behalf about such items as cost and schedule. He or she serves as the company's point of contact both with the client and with the general public. A project manager also takes part in selecting and mentoring project staff and ensuring that the entire team works together efficiently to complete the project safely, on time and on budget.
Responsibilities :
Work on high-profile projects, assisting in planning, organizing, and controlling various elements of the job.
Planning early to avoid unnecessary safety risks, address production and quality concerns and allow time for input and buy in from stakeholders
Making thoughtful, timely decisions to keep the project moving forward
Having a strategic vs. tactical approach to problem solving (see big picture - investigate vs. define)
Contributing to winning new work including participating by in the estimating, proposal and presentation efforts (project champion)
Familiarity with state and local compliance and regulatory requirements
Communicating clearly, following up, providing support and holding team accountable for deadlines
Practicing "win win" negotiation
Knowing insurance products and coverages for Atkinson, subcontractors and vendors as well as the status of subcontractors and vendors insurance
Keeping stakeholders informed.
Actively pursue and engage in safety training to learn and embrace the Atkinson safety culture
Participate in the TRACK process; attend daily / weekly meetings and field inspections
Initiate and maintain good, strong working relationships with Atkinson's craft personnel, field inspectors, subcontractor's representatives, vendors, home office support, the project management team, the community, etc.
Stay ahead of the crew's needs making sure they are efficient in their work
Prioritize daily tasks by understanding deadlines and material procurement lead times
Provide prompt, accurate information, notices and requests to agencies, subcontractors, vendors, etc.
Communicate clearly and concisely in a grammatically correct and unbiased manner
Investigate issues, ask thoughtful questions, gather input and propose solutions
Beat the estimated budget
Pursue self development outside of assigned responsibilities
Produce safe, efficient construction engineering products
Track and update quantities timely to ensure accurate budgets, forecasts and reporting
Perform thorough invoice reviews and pay subcontractors and vendors timely
Gather and prepare supporting documentation for change orders and requisitions
Qualifications :
Undergraduate degree in engineering, construction management, business, or a related discipline
Minimum of 8 years of engineering and general contracting experience on $30Mto $250M complex, self-perform, heavy underground / tunneling construction projects
Experience managing more than one project simultaneously
High degree of initiative, independence, personal responsibility and integrity
Strong interpersonal skills
Effective oral and written communication skills
Strong work ethic and ability to work in a fast-paced team environment
Team player and reliable
Atkinson offers a total compensation package that includes base salary, bonus potential, and a comprehensive benefit package that includes health benefits (medical and dental plans), paid time off (vacation, sick and holiday), financial benefits (retirement plan with both match and annual company contribution, life insurance, short and long term disability, and commuter benefits). Additional benefits include fitness reimbursement, healthcare and dependent care pre-tax spending plans, tuition reimbursement, back-up daycare and family support benefits, EAP, work life assistance and a holiday contribution program. Base salaries will be determined by factors such as geographic location, education, skills, experience, and market considerations. For this role the base salary range is $100,000 to $190,000 .
